Frequently asked by parents

How do I choose a pediatric therapist for my child?
Start with three things: credentials (state license + relevant certification - e.g. CCC-SLP for speech, OTR/L for OT, BCBA for ABA), specialty fit for your child's diagnosis or concern, and whether the therapist takes your insurance. What's the difference between OT and PT?
Occupational therapy (OT) helps a child do the activities of daily life - handwriting, dressing, feeding, regulating sensory input, fine-motor tasks. Physical therapy (PT) focuses on gross-motor skills - crawling, walking, balance, strength, gait. Some kids work with both.

What age should my child start speech therapy?
There is no minimum age - early intervention programs (birth–3) and pediatric SLPs work with infants and toddlers. If your pediatrician has flagged a concern, or your child isn't hitting language milestones, it's reasonable to seek an evaluation.
How long does pediatric therapy take?
It varies widely - articulation work might wrap in 6–9 months; sensory-integration OT or ABA programs can run 1–3 years. Most therapists do a formal evaluation, set goals, and re-assess every 6 months so you can see measurable progress.
Can my child do online (telehealth) therapy?
Yes - most speech and mental-health providers offer telehealth, and many OTs offer hybrid programs. ABA, PT, and feeding therapy are usually in-person or hybrid.
